The fire crew had been called out to tackle a fire in a somebody’s kitchen, but whilst they were out, there was a fire in the station’s own kitchen.
The incident occurred in Guadalajara on a Tuesday night. They had received an emergency call because a frying-pan fire had set a kitchen alight somewhere in the town, so off they bravely rushed and quickly dispatched the cowering fire.
After packing away the hoses and patting themselves on the back they returned to the station find that the crew-room kitchen had suffered a fire, as well.
How did it happen? They had been preparing their supper when they received the call and in their haste to leave had forgotten about the food on the stove.
Neighbours had seen the smoke coming from the station but had thought that it had been an exercise – I mean, you don’t expect a fire in a fire station, do you?
They Mayor wasn’t happy… or perhaps he secretly was because the town firemen had been protesting before the Town Hall recently about a pay rise and better equipment…
